911 GT3 S/C with a high-revving naturally aspirated engine and manual transmission

The Porsche GT family welcomes a particularly exciting new member. The 911 GT3 S/C allows fans of the high-revving boxer engine to enjoy its unique naturally aspirated sound even without a fixed roof. It combines a range of ‘driver's car’ qualities that have already delighted customers of the limited-edition 911 Speedster and 911 S/T models.

For the first time, Porsche is introducing a 911 GT3 with a fully automatic convertible roof. The 911 GT3 S/C, designed especially with driving pleasure in mind, combines the lightweight design of the 911 S/T with the naturally aspirated 4.0-litre boxer engine of the 911 GT3, producing 375 kW (510 PS) and 450 Nm of torque. The distinctive wings and doors of the 911 S/T in combination with the black windscreen surround give the new 911 GT3 S/C an unmistakable look.
